Deklyn
An invented name inspired by the Latin word "declinare", meaning to deviate or diverge.
Name Census estimates that about 938 living Americans carry the first name Deklyn. It appears on both sides of the gender split, with 80.1% of registrations being male. The average person named Deklyn today is around 9 years old, and the year with the single highest number of Deklyn births was 2015 (86 babies).

Gender
Gender distribution for Deklyn
Deklyn leans heavily male at 80.1% of total registrations, but 188 girls have also been registered with the name over the years, giving it a small but present crossover presence.

Popularity
Deklyn: popularity over time
The SSA tracks Deklyn from the 2000s through to the 2020s, spanning 3 decades of birth certificate data. The biggest single decade for the name was the 2010s, with 623 total registrations. Although the numbers have come down from the 2010s peak, Deklyn remains solidly in use and shows no sign of disappearing from maternity wards.

Geography
Where Deklyns live
The SSA's state-level files cover 12 states and territories. Texas, Michigan, California recorded the most babies named Deklyn, while Ohio, Missouri, Minnesota recorded the fewest. The average across all reporting states is about 9 registrations each.

How many people in the U.S. are named Deklyn?
Name Census puts the figure at roughly 938 living Americans. We arrive at this by taking every SSA birth registration for Deklyn going back to 1880 and adjusting each cohort for expected survival using CDC actuarial life tables. The result is an age-weighted living-bearer count, not a raw birth total. That works out to about 1 in 365,410 US residents.

Where does this data come from?
First-name figures come from the Social Security Administration's national baby name files, which cover every name on a birth certificate from 1880 to 2024. Living-bearer estimates layer in CDC actuarial life tables broken out by sex to account for mortality. The population baseline (342,754,338) is the Census Bureau's latest national estimate.
